For the 2025 school year, there are 6 public high schools serving 7,463 students in Tippecanoe County, IN.
The top ranked public high schools in Tippecanoe County, IN are West Lafayette Jr/sr High School, William Henry Harrison High School and Mccutcheon High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Tippecanoe County, IN public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 42% (versus the Indiana public high school average of 29%), and reading proficiency score of 55% (versus the 46% statewide average). High schools in Tippecanoe County have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 10% of Indiana public high schools.
Tippecanoe County, IN public high school have a Graduation Rate of 92%, which is more than the Indiana average of 89%.
The school with highest graduation rate is William Henry Harrison High School, with 97%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Indiana or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 40%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Indiana public high school average of 36% (majority Hispanic and Black).
